2016 - 2024

感恩一路有你

探索高德地图动态点绘制的技巧

浏览量:4050 时间:2024-05-26 00:03:08 作者:采采

在当今数字化社会,利用高德地图实现动态点的规划路线成为了一种常见的需求。通过绘制不同类型的线或轨迹,如折线、圆、多边形等,我们可以监测运动物体的路线,实现动态规划路线。接下来将通过一个示例来说明如何绘制不同个数点的线,在动态变化时呈现出不同的情况。

创建静态页面和引入高德地图

首先,在web项目中的pages目录下新建静态页面,并引入高德地图核心的css和js文件。确保兼容各种浏览器,同时添加适配不同设备的代码。在页面中插入一个带有id属性的div标签作为地图容器,并设置相关样式属性。

初始化高德地图并设置坐标

在div标签后插入script标签,进行高德地图的初始化工作。设定地图的放大级别以及中心点位置坐标,这将是我们绘制动态点的起始位置。继续声明一个数组lineArr并赋值,利用高德地图的Polyline类来画线,可以设置线条的颜色、粗细、透明度等属性。

预览并动态添加点坐标

完成基本设置后,在浏览器中进行预览,即可看到已经绘制好的直线,根据地图经纬度展现规划路线。若需要设计曲线,可以在lineArr数组中再添加点坐标。保存后再次预览网页,线条会随着新增点的加入而发生变化,呈现出折线的效果。

结合实际场景优化路线规划

在实际应用中,可以根据具体需求进一步优化路线规划。通过高德地图丰富的功能和API支持,我们可以实现从简单直线到复杂曲线的动态点绘制,满足不同场景下的定制化需求。同时,合理利用高德地图提供的属性和方法,能够更好地展示动态点的移动路径,为用户提供更加直观的信息展示。

通过以上步骤和技巧,我们可以灵活运用高德地图的功能,绘制出符合实际应用需求的动态点规划路线。在日常生活和工作中,随着对地图展示需求的不断增加,掌握这些绘制技巧将有助于提升地图展示的效果和用户体验。愿本文内容能为您在高德地图动态点绘制方面提供一定的帮助与启发。

版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。